Why Runners Need a Dedicated Stretching Board
Running places immense, repetitive stress on the lower legs, with the calf muscles and Achilles tendons absorbing several times your body weight with every stride. Over time, this continuous loading can lead to adaptive shortening of the muscle fibers, resulting in restricted ankle dorsiflexion and increased stiffness. A dedicated stretching board addresses this issue by providing a controlled incline that isolates the target tissues far more effectively than flat-ground stretching methods.

When you perform a standard calf stretch against a wall or on a flat floor, it is incredibly easy to unconsciously cheat the movement. To avoid the discomfort of a deep stretch, your body may naturally turn your foot outward, collapse your arch, or lift your heel slightly off the ground. These subtle postural compensations reduce the tension on the calf muscles and can place unwanted lateral stress on your ankle and knee joints. An incline board eliminates these compensations by locking your foot into a fixed, flat position, forcing your ankle into true dorsiflexion and ensuring that the stretch is delivered precisely where it is needed.
Furthermore, a stretching board allows for the targeted isolation of the two primary muscles that make up the calf: the gastrocnemius and the soleus. The gastrocnemius is the larger, outer muscle that crosses both the knee and ankle joints, meaning it is best stretched when the knee is fully extended. The soleus lies beneath the gastrocnemius and does not cross the knee, requiring a bent-knee position to isolate. By providing a stable, angled platform, a stretching board allows you to easily transition between straight-leg and bent-knee positions, ensuring both muscle groups receive comprehensive recovery.
Finally, managing the load on your Achilles tendon is critical for preventing overuse injuries. The Achilles tendon requires a gradual, progressive application of tension to maintain its elasticity and strength. Using a stretching board allows you to select a precise angle of incline, ensuring that you do not overstretch or shock fatigued tissues immediately after a hard run. This level of control is virtually impossible to achieve when bouncing on the edge of a curb or pushing haphazardly against a wall, making the board a much safer option for long-term tendon health.
Key Features to Look for in a Running Recovery Board
When shopping for a stretching board in Singapore, it is important to evaluate several key features to ensure the tool fits your training volume, body weight, and home environment. Not all boards are constructed the same way, and selecting one without considering these factors can lead to a frustrating user experience or even safety hazards during use.

First and foremost, consider the adjustability and angle range of the board. A high-quality recovery board should offer multiple incline settings, typically ranging from a gentle 15 degrees to a challenging 40 degrees or more. This adjustability is crucial because your flexibility will naturally fluctuate depending on your training volume, fatigue levels, and individual anatomy. Beginners or runners recovering from minor strains should start at a very low angle to avoid overstressing the tissues, while highly flexible runners can gradually increase the incline as their range of motion improves. Look for boards that offer clear, secure increment steps so you can track your progress over time.
Material durability and weight capacity are equally critical, especially if you plan to use the board daily or perform active exercises like calf raises on it. Stretching boards are generally constructed from wood, heavy-duty plastic, or steel. Wood and steel options typically offer the highest weight capacities and structural rigidity, making them ideal for heavier runners or those who want a completely solid feel underfoot. Always verify the manufacturer’s specified weight limit before purchasing, and ensure the board can comfortably support your full body weight without flexing or creaking.
Surface grip and foot placement design are vital safety features, particularly in Singapore’s warm and humid climate where sweat is a constant factor. A slippery board can lead to sudden falls or joint strains if your foot slides off during a deep stretch. Look for boards that feature high-friction grip tape, textured rubber pads, or molded non-slip ridges. Additionally, some boards include a raised heel lip or a curved bottom edge to help keep your foot securely positioned on the incline, which is especially helpful when stretching barefoot or in socks.
Lastly, consider the board’s portability and storage footprint. Many runners in Singapore live in apartments or HDB flats where living space is at a premium. A bulky, non-folding board can quickly become an eyesore or a tripping hazard if left out in the open. Opting for a model that folds completely flat allows you to easily slide the board under a sofa, bed, or television console when not in use. If you plan to bring your board to the track, gym, or on travels for overseas races, look for lightweight materials and integrated carrying handles that make transport hassle-free.

Adjustable Multi-Angle Boards
Adjustable multi-angle boards are the most versatile option for runners, offering the ability to customize the incline to suit your daily flexibility levels. These boards typically feature a hinged design with a support bar that slots into various pre-cut grooves or pegs on the base, allowing you to quickly change the angle.
When evaluating an adjustable board, closely inspect the locking mechanism and support pegs for structural stability. The slots should be deep and secure enough to prevent the support bar from slipping out of place when you stand on the board. Wooden adjustable boards often feature robust, interlocking wooden teeth, while plastic or metal models may use steel pins or heavy-duty plastic slots.
These boards are ideal for runners who share their recovery gear with family members of varying flexibility levels, or for individuals who want to incrementally increase their stretch angle over a structured training cycle. Always verify the maximum weight capacity listed by the manufacturer to ensure the adjustable joints can safely handle your weight at the steepest settings.
Fixed-Incline Wooden or Foam Boards
Fixed-incline boards offer a simpler, no-fuss alternative to adjustable models. These boards are set at a single, permanent angle—typically between 20 and 25 degrees—and are often constructed from solid wood or high-density foam blocks.
If you are considering a fixed-incline board, it is essential to evaluate whether the pre-set angle matches your current level of calf flexibility. If the angle is too steep, you may find yourself unable to stand on the board comfortably without bending your knees or arching your back, which defeats the purpose of the stretch. Conversely, if the angle is too shallow, you may not feel an adequate stretch as your flexibility improves.
Foam wedges are particularly popular for their lightweight, soft texture, and quiet operation, making them excellent for apartment living where you want to avoid clattering heavy equipment on tiled floors. However, because foam can compress slightly under heavy loads, ensure you choose high-density foam that maintains its shape, and check if you need to add grip tape or wear shoes to prevent slipping on the smooth foam surface.
Compact and Foldable Travel Boards
For runners who travel frequently for races, commute to track sessions, or simply have very limited storage space, compact and foldable travel boards are an excellent solution. These boards are designed to fold down into an incredibly slim profile, often measuring just a few centimeters in thickness when fully collapsed.
When inspecting portable options, pay close attention to the durability of the hinges and the overall structural integrity when the board is fully deployed. Because these boards rely on folding joints to support your weight, the quality of the hardware is paramount. Look for rust-resistant metal hinges and reinforced plastic frames that can withstand the humid conditions of Singapore without degrading.
Ensure the folded footprint of the board fits comfortably within standard gym bags or luggage dimensions if you plan to travel with it. Keep in mind that compact models may have trade-offs, such as a slightly smaller foot platform, a lower maximum weight capacity, or fewer incline options compared to full-size, heavy-duty home models.
How to Use a Stretching Board Safely Post-Run
Using a stretching board is highly effective, but it must be done with proper technique and safety precautions to avoid straining your muscles or tendons. Because your tissues are highly fatigued immediately after a run, applying sudden or excessive force can lead to micro-tears and prolonged recovery times.
First, never step onto a steep incline board with completely cold or highly fatigued muscles without a brief transition period. Immediately after stopping your run, your muscles are warm, but they are also neurologically fatigued and may be prone to cramping or sudden spasms. Spend a few minutes walking to let your heart rate return to a near-normal state, or perform some light, active mobility exercises before stepping onto the board. If you are using the board on a non-running day, perform a quick five-minute warm-up, such as gentle bodyweight squats or walking, to increase blood flow to the lower legs before stretching.
Second, understand the difference between normal stretching discomfort and sharp, localized pain. A proper stretch should feel like a deep, dull pull throughout the belly of the calf muscle. It should never feel like a sharp, burning, or stabbing sensation, particularly near the heel or the back of the ankle where the Achilles tendon inserts. If you experience any sharp pain, numbness, or tingling in your feet or toes, step off the board immediately. Keep your stretch duration to a controlled 20 to 30 seconds per set, repeating 2 to 3 times, rather than standing on the board for extended, uninterrupted periods.
Finally, pay close attention to your foot placement and overall posture alignment. Stand tall on the board with your feet parallel and pointing straight ahead; turning your toes inward or outward alters the mechanics of the stretch and can strain your joints. Keep your hips pushed forward and your spine neutral, avoiding the temptation to lean backward or stick your glutes out to ease the stretch. To target the gastrocnemius, keep your knees fully locked and straight. To target the soleus, slightly bend your knees while keeping your heels firmly planted on the board. This simple adjustment ensures a comprehensive, safe recovery session.
Frequently Asked Questions (FAQ)
Can a stretching board help with plantar fasciitis?
Tightness in the calf muscles is a common contributing factor to plantar fasciitis. Because the calf muscles connect directly to the heel bone via the Achilles tendon, tight calves can pull on the heel, which in turn increases the tension and strain on the plantar fascia ligament under the foot. Using a stretching board to gently improve calf flexibility can help reduce this secondary tension on the bottom of your foot. However, if you are experiencing acute, sharp heel pain or suspect you have active plantar fasciitis, it is highly recommended to consult a physiotherapist or medical professional before using an incline board, as aggressive stretching can sometimes aggravate an inflamed fascia.
How long should I stand on a stretching board after a run?
For post-run recovery, it is generally recommended to perform static stretches holding for 20 to 30 seconds per set, repeating the stretch 2 to 3 times for each leg. Avoid standing on the board for long, continuous periods of several minutes, as this can overstretch the tissues and lead to temporary muscle weakness or joint instability. Always start with shorter intervals at a lower incline to see how your muscles respond, and gradually adjust based on your personal comfort limits. Always follow the manufacturer’s specific usage guidelines, and stop immediately if you experience any numbness, tingling, or sharp pain.
Should I use the stretching board with or without shoes?
Whether you use a stretching board with or without shoes depends largely on your personal comfort, hygiene preferences, and the board’s surface texture. Stretching barefoot or in socks allows for better natural foot mechanics, helps strengthen the intrinsic muscles of the foot, and provides a more direct stretch. However, if you choose this method, you must ensure the board has a highly secure, non-slip surface to prevent your feet from sliding. Wearing running shoes provides extra cushioning, structured arch support, and is often the preferred choice for hygiene when using a shared board in a public gym or fitness studio.
